Zusammenfassung: | Suppose that a Hilbert scheme of points on a K3 surface S of Picard rank one
admits a rational Lagrangian fibration. We show that if the degree of the
surface is sufficiently large compared to the number of points, then the
Hilbert scheme is the unique hyperk\"ahler manifold in its birational class. In
particular, the Hilbert scheme is a Lagrangian fibration itself, which we
realize as coming from a (twisted) Beauville-Mukai system on a Fourier-Mukai
partner of S. We also show that when the degree of the surface is small our
method can be used to find all birational models of the Hilbert scheme. |
